The new M12 is constructed by OZ Racing in Italy. This wheel was originally designed specifically for the Castrol Mugen NSX JGTC racecar. Now this wheels is available in Silver for your Honda or Acura, complete with Mugen and OZ Racing logos and Mugen Center cap.
17x7JJ, +50, 5x114.3, 20 lbs. 42700-M125-770S-50 $420.00/each
17x7JJ, +42, 5x114.3, 20 lbs. 42700-M125-770S-42 $420.00/each

An 18" tire is like a +3 conversion. Your tire will be like a 30 aspect ratio - not safe! (unless you like buying replacements for bent rims). Get 17"s instead.
